产研协同构建 RISC-V 统一内核底座 —— RVCK 内核同源计划阶段性进展

RVEI工委会 2026-03-09 22:02

产研协同构建 RISC-V 统一内核底座 —— RVCK 内核同源计划阶段性进展图1 更多精彩,请点击上方蓝字关注RVEI

产研协同构建 RISC-V 统一内核底座 —— RVCK 内核同源计划阶段性进展图2


RISC-V 内核同源计划



近年来,RISC-V 产业生态持续发展,面向服务器的多种操作系统适配与生态整合需求不断上升。在此背景下,如意社区发起内核同源计划(RVCK, RISC-V Common Kernel),致力于构建统一的内核基础能力体系,降低多操作系统、多硬件平台并行适配带来的维护复杂度,提升软硬件上下游协同效率。



01



总体介绍


RVCK 计划全面支持国产操作系统 RISC-V 版本研发,致力于构建统一的内核能力底座,为不同芯片平台提供可复用、可扩展的基础软件支持体系。


2024 年 7 月以来,中国科学院软件研究所(简称软件所)智能软件研究中心联合阿里巴巴达摩院、中兴通讯、进迭时空、算能、超睿科技等产业伙伴,以及开源欧拉、开源龙蜥、开云、开放麒麟、深度等国产操作系统社区协同推进 RVCK 相关工作,围绕 RISC-V 服务器基础能力完善、统一内核体系建设及多硬件平台适配持续开展工作。




02



当前进展


在产业与科研机构共同推进下,RVCK 在代码规模、产业参与度以及硬件平台支持等方面取得阶段性成果。

RVCK 当前基于 Linux 6.6 LTS(长期支持)主线版本[1] 推进服务器方向能力建设,并以 v6.6.127 作为统计起始基线截至 2026 年 3 月 4 日,RVCK 累计合入 1182 个补丁[2]在多方共同参与下,RVCK 逐步形成了较为均衡的产业参与格局,主要贡献情况如下:
  • 阿里巴巴达摩院:289 个提交,占比 24.5%

  • 中兴通讯:256 个提交,占比 21.7%

  • 软件所252 个提交,占比 21.3%

  • 进迭时空:134 个提交,占比 11.3%

  • 算能:98 个提交,占比 8.3%

  • 超睿科技:85 个提交,占比 7.2%


03



协同研发机制建设


RVCK 构建了多方参与、协同开发、按需集成的研发机制通过统一内核代码基线,减少了硬件厂商在不同操作系统社区的重复适配工作


现阶段,RVCK 已成为芯片厂商推动国产操作系统适配的重要技术平台。2025 年国产操作系统社区开源欧拉[3]、开源龙蜥[4]、开放麒麟[5] 发布的 RISC-V RVA23 版本均使用 RVCK 同源内核成果


04



核心技术进展与产业贡献


在 RVA23 与服务器能力建设方面[6]RVCK 汇聚产业与学术界的核心力量,持续推进关键内核能力建设,已形成覆盖 RVA23 的服务器级能力框架


RVA23 及相关扩展

围绕 RISC-V 架构扩展能力建设,在软件所、中兴通讯、阿里巴巴达摩院的贡献下,RVCK 实现了标准化的 RISC-V 扩展探测机制 (HWPROBE)并推动相关实现与主线内核保持同步。关键成果包括RISC-V 扩展探测、关键扩展内核支持(如 Zicbop、Zba/Zbb/Zbc、Zacas/Zabha 等),为服务器级部署提供统一架构基础


ACPI 子系统

中兴通讯、阿里巴巴达摩院、算能的贡献下,RVCK 持续完善服务器级平台基础能力,已支持 ACPI IOMMU配置、CPPC驱动、处理器电源管理、性能状态调整、NUMA 拓扑、PCIe 配置等基础设施,并在 IOMMU(IO 内存管理单元)体系架构方向持续优化,增强服务器平台的可管理性与可扩展能力

高级中断架构

围绕新一代 RISC-V 中断架构与虚拟化能力建设,在软件所、算能的贡献下,RVCK 已完成新一代中断体系核心能力构建,实现了 AIA 驱动支持、RINTC、IMSIC、APLIC 和 PLIC 等中断控制器及 ACPI 支持,构建面向服务器场景的完整中断处理框架


    服务器特性

    围绕服务器级可靠性与可维护能力建设,在阿里巴巴达摩院、中兴通讯的贡献下,RVCK 持续完善服务器关键特性能力,主要优化点包括RISC-V IOMMU 架构驱动的基础支持、SSE(Supervisor Software Events)扩展支持、RAS(可靠性、可用性和可维护性)与 QoS(服务质量),以及 KVM(内核虚拟机)性能优化,为 RISC-V 服务器平台的可管理性与企业级特性提供基础能力支撑


      安全机制

      围绕服务器安全能力与性能分析体系建设,在软件所、阿里巴巴达摩院、中兴通讯的贡献下,RVCK 持续完善安全扩展与性能观测能力建设,重点包括指针掩码扩展探测能力支持、Zkr 随机数扩展支持以及向量加密(Vector Crypto)能力支持


        性能优化

        围绕服务器性能分析与性能调优能力建设,在阿里巴巴达摩院的贡献下,RVCK 持续完善性能监控单元 (PMU) 与 Perf 子系统支持能力,增强服务器性能分析与调优体系,提升服务器场景下的性能观测与调优能力


        标准化外设支持能力

        围绕通用外设标准化支持能力建设,在算能、进迭时空、阿里巴巴达摩院的贡献下,RVCK 持续完善标准外设与平台设备支持能力,适配范围覆盖 16550 兼容 UART、PCIe 控制器、SDHCI 存储控制器、EMAC 网络控制器以及多种电源管理芯片,并完善显示与音频子系统能力,实现主流服务器外设在同源内核下的统一驱动支持


        硬件平台支持能力

        围绕主流国产 RISC-V 硬件平台适配,在阿里巴巴达摩院、超睿科技、算能、进迭时空的贡献下,RVCK 持续开展主流芯片平台适配工作,目前已完成 TH1520、DP1000、SG2042/SG2044、K1/K3 等平台适配,实现不同芯片平台在 RVCK 同源内核下的统一适配支持


        05



        2026 技术演进规划


        2026 年,RVCK 将持续深化服务器方向能力建设,各核心贡献单位已形成明确年度规划。

        中兴通讯:强化内核特性与服务器基础能力[7]

        中兴通讯将持续优化内核核心功能与服务器关键特性,包括完善 Perf 驱动、支持 lscpu Socket 数解析、优化用户态拷贝(uaccess)性能与对齐机制、提升 swab 与 futex 性能以及 CPU 并行启动效率,并引入 BGRT 开机 Logo、RAID6 优化与 ZBB 校验和优化等功能增强;在架构能力方面,将持续跟进主线进展,合入硬件断点、Sxcsrind、ZALASR、1G THP、Zilsd/Zclsd 等扩展,推进软脏位、用户态缺页异常写保护、TLB flush 优化与硬锁检测等特性,并完成 OpenSBI 3.0 中 MPXY、RPMI 与 FWFT 等机制适配,提升固件与内核之间的配合能力


        阿里巴巴达摩院:聚焦虚拟化增强、安全机制与性能分析体系[8]

        阿里巴巴达摩院将反合主线向量加密(Vector Crypto)扩展,并引入内核非对齐访问探测机制以提升系统健壮性;在虚拟化方向支持 Steal time、客户机 PMU 优化与 perf record,同步反合 KVM 上游功能并修复已知问题;在安全方面引入 RISC-V Pointer Masking(Ssnpm/Smnpm/Smmpm)与 CFI(zicfilp/zicfiss),增强系统对内存破坏类攻击的防护能力;同时完善 RAS、QoS/CBQRI、IOMMU 社区功能补充,增强 ACPI、PMU(DDR、PCIe 等)与各类驱动支持,并完善 PTDUMP 功能与 Xuantie Ntrace 支持。


        超睿科技:夯实性能监控与虚拟化可观测能力

        超睿科技将同步推进设备树(DT)与 ACPI 两种模式下的 PMU 事件传递机制,确保不同启动方式下性能监控的一致性,并持续合入 Perf 驱动优化补丁;同时跟进上游进展,引入 KVM 虚拟化性能观测点,并完善 ACPI 相关支持与固件适配能力

        进迭时空:推进 K1/K3 平台主线化与生态扩展

        进迭时空将围绕 SpacemiT K1 与 K3 平台持续推进主线化进程,逐步以主线补丁替换 RVCK 中的对应实现(如 clock、reset 已完成部分替换),并补齐 USB、PCIe 等模块;针对 K3 平台,计划于 2026 年 7 月前将全部模块的 Review Patch 提交至主线社区,优先完成 SD/eMMC 存储与 GMAC 以太网功能适配,其他模块将根据主线进展反合至 RVCK,并持续关注 IOMMU 主线进支持情况。

        软件所:优化基础设施与协作测试体系

        软件所将围绕 RVCK 基础设施建设持续推进相关工作,增强 RAVA 门禁系统能力,完善自动化测试平台并接入更多真实硬件设备,提升补丁合入前的验证覆盖度;同时优化贡献统计分支与可视化展示能力,更清晰地呈现各机构在代码提交、补丁审阅与主线化等维度的贡献情况

        联系我们



        对 OERV 工作感兴趣的伙伴们可以加入到 openEuler RISC-V 社区开发群,获取更多即时信息。OERV 团队长期招收 全职/兼职/实习生,欢迎投递简历至邮箱 wangjingwei@iscas.ac.cn


        相关链接



        [1] 6.6 LTS 支持期延长:https://www.phoronix.com/news/Linux-6.18-LTS-6.12-6.6-Extend

        [2] RVCK 内核贡献统计报告:https://github.com/RVCK-Project/rvck/blob/contrib-stats/docs/index.md

        [3] 开源欧拉 RISC-V RVA23 版本发布:https://mp.weixin.qq.com/s/NiSuWP5KwT5BQqTENEbaLg

        [4] 开源龙蜥 RVA23 发布相关新闻:https://mp.weixin.qq.com/s/uIkeNi8sXHB-55jXUaT7jw

        [5] 开放麒麟首个 RISC-V RVA23 版本发布: https://mp.weixin.qq.com/s/p2pWI4wEhXdWCmWadIcqNg

        [6] RISC-V Server Platform 规范仓库:https://github.com/riscv-non-isa/riscv-server-platform

        [7] 中兴通讯 2026 年 RVCK 内核开发计划:https://github.com/RVCK-Project/rvck/issues/204

        [8] 阿里巴巴达摩院 2026 年 RVCK 内核开发计划:https://github.com/RVCK-Project/rvck/issues/223



        来源:OERV

        产研协同构建 RISC-V 统一内核底座 —— RVCK 内核同源计划阶段性进展图3


        声明:内容取材于网络,仅代表作者观点,如有内容违规问题,请联系处理。 
        RISC-V
        more
        RISC-V的“窗口期”:从国家战略到地方落子,一场换道超车的产业变革
        国产RISC-V AI算力芯片规模量产!类TPU架构迎爆发
        力芯微电子:以RISC-V为核心驱动电源管理芯片创新,拓展物联网与汽车电子应用
        北京人形天工平台核心运控系统率先完成国产RISC-V芯片验证
        行业速递丨RISC-V+AI融合落地、RISC-V产业链融资加速、RISC-V设计生态协同
        苏州大学:深耕RISC-V人才培养,夯实实践教学基础
        RISC-V+行业智能 | 金刚C信创智能NAS存储筑牢中小学数据安全底座
        RISC-V+行业智能 | 金刚V:当卫星通信遇见RISC-V,窄带传输不再“窄”
        TC1 RISC-V 芯片成功点亮、验证完成!欧洲超算自主可控里程碑
        300%性能提升!砺睿微引领RISC-V与x265的深度优化
        Copyright © 2025 成都区角科技有限公司
        蜀ICP备2025143415号-1
          
        川公网安备51015602001305号